The THS3092 and are dual high-voltage, low-distortion, high speed, current-feedback amplifiers designed to operate over a wide supply range of ±5 V to ±15 V for applications requiring large, linear output signals such as Pin, Power FET, and VDSL line drivers.
The THS3096 features a power-down pin PD that puts the amplifier in low power standby mode, and lowers the quiescent current from 9.5 mA to 500 µA.
The wide supply range combined with total harmonic distortion as low as -66 dBc at 10 MHz, in addition, to the high slew rate of 5700 V/µs makes the THS3092/6 ideally suited for high-voltage arbitrary waveform driver applications. Moreover, having the ability to handle large voltage swings driving into high-resistance and high-capacitance loads while maintaining good settling time performance makes the THS3092/6 ideal for Pin driver and PowerFET driver applications.
The THS3092 is offered in an 8-pin SOIC D, and the 8-pin SOIC DDA packages with PowerPAD. The THS3096 is offered in the 8-pin SOIC D and the 14-pin TSSOP PWP packages with PowerPAD.
